Reporting to the Finance Director, the Financial Accountant is responsible for ensuring accurate financial reporting, maintaining compliance with UK financial regulations and standards and running the month end close process.
 
Key Responsibilities will include:

  • Preparing monthly financial statements in accordance with IFRS.
  • Maintaining and reconciling the general ledger and subsidiary accounts.
  • Ensuring the accuracy of all financial reporting and that company cashflow is being managed efficiently and effectively.
  • Reviewing and supporting on payroll submissions and pension submission completion. Complete variance analysis against budget/forecast and prior year.
  • Supporting the Year End Audit, ensuring all data and monthly processes have been undertaken to ensure the audit is completed to time, with minimal disruption to the business and with as few exceptions/queries raised as possible.
  • Ensuring all Month and Year End tasks and associated reporting are completed by the Finance team correctly, within specified timescales (e.g. within 5 days).
  • Providing up to date management information for the Monthly Financial Reviews; investigate variances and identifying areas for commercial improvement.
  • Supporting the preparation and submission of all Statutory Accounts.
  • Ensuring compliance with HMRC regulations, including preparation of VAT, PAYE, and Corporation Tax returns. Ensuring payments are made on time.
  • Supporting implementation and improvement of internal financial controls and accounting systems.
  • Staying up to date with changes in financial regulations and legislation.
  • Assisting with additional projects where required, as directed by the Finance Director or the Group Chief Finance Officer.

The successful Candidate will be a Professionally Qualified individual with exceptional financial accounting experience including VAT and Tax matters and a strong understanding of UK accounting principles and regulatory frameworks. They will possess effective communication skills to liaise with internal and external stakeholders, excellent analytical experience, and genuine commercial acumen, with a strong focus on profitability.
